Transaction 18f7528c516f6fd51380fd8041619d1fd80adb58a7c1485280d2cd43e33cebd6
1 Input
1 Output
-
18f7528c516f6fd51380fd8041619d1fd80adb58a7c1485280d2cd43e33cebd6:0
- value
- 757789
- script pubkey
- OP_0 OP_PUSHBYTES_20 c952d90a45e61339c9adbf4ef814ca01c7e36181
- address
- bc1qe9fdjzj9ucfnnjddha80s9x2q8r7xcvpsgd58e